    A young woman dances with a man in costume at a Day of the Dead parade in Oaxaca, Mexico. Some residents dress up  similar to Halloween while others spend time in more traditional ways by decorating, praying & socializing in the graveyards. This woman did not realize that she was surrounded by other masked men that also wanted to dance with her.
